From 21st Century Science and Health

“Having money and possessions may remove some barriers to a happy marriage, but nothing can replace the loving care in a union.

“Gentle words, and an unselfish attention to detail in what promotes the success of your spouse, will prove valuable in prolonging one another’s health and smiles. Don’t practice stolid indifference or resentment. Remember, a simple heartfelt word or deed is powerful enough to renew the romance.”
